### CI Note: PickPath Optimizer flakiness

New folks: if the PickPath optimizer suite fails on the Brindlecote runner, it's almost always the seeded warehouse fixture timing out, not your change. Re-run once before panicking. If it fails twice, check that the solver cache volume mounted — a missing mount makes every test cold-start. Ping the infra channel if the cache looks empty. The failing build's token is pasted below.

session token of tajef-bageg = htk21_5d90d574934f3ccae6437

## Action Item: PDF invoice renderer timeouts

During the Billows quarter-close run, the Papercrane invoice renderer exhausted its worker pool because oversized line-item tables triggered repeated pagination passes. For new team members: the renderer is synchronous per invoice, so one slow document blocks its worker entirely. The fix is a hard per-document render budget plus a page cap, both now configurable. The agreed values, which ship in the next release, are listed below.

tuning table, yajog-yahof:
BUDGETS = {
    "lamvan": 303,
    "wenox": 460,
    "fenvan": 525,
}

Ticket: FIELD-2281 — Expired credentials blocking offline sync

For the weekly sync: the Heronpath field-survey app's offline mode stopped reconciling on Monday because the cached sync token expired while crews were out of coverage. Surveys queued locally are intact, but uploads fail silently until re-auth. We've extended token lifetime to 30 days and reissued credentials. The replacement key for the internal sync service follows.

service key, fafog-fahaf: vxb3-x55